Subsection How to be successful in BUAN 3500
- Come to class and pay attention/be engaged as we’re working in class.
- Ask for help as soon as you realize you need it!
- Come to office hours!
- Commit to spending a minimum of 5 hours per week (split among at least 3 different days) to complete and submit the assignments for the course on time.
- Form a study group with your classmates and meet regularly to work on the material.
- Check UCCS email daily for updates or Canvas announcements regarding the course, and reply to those messages when appropriate.
- Regularly review the syllabus/calendar so you don’t miss due dates.
- Read/study the book!
